Performance

The vivo S9e's Mediatek Dimensity 820 generally provides a more modern and efficient performance compared to the Kirin 970 in the P20 Pro. While the Kirin 970 was a flagship chipset in its time, the Dimensity 820 benefits from newer architecture and manufacturing process (7nm vs 10nm), leading to potentially better gaming performance and overall responsiveness. However, real-world usage will depend on software optimization.
